I got real lucky in that it PERFECTLY fits into the slots on the sides of my toaster oven, while I thought I was going to have to use it the long way (my oven is a little deeper than it is wide). It is easy to clean as long as you clean it soon (or soak it) before anything can dry on it. Suggest using some spray oil to help that, and (I figured out a long time ago), I put a little water in the bottom tray when I'm broiling. Nothing sticks or dries on if you do that. I purchased this in Apr 2015. I have an older Oster 6295 6-slice toaster oven that came with an aluminum broiling tray and pan. The aluminum was too soft that, eventually, the tray and pan warped and got bent out of shape in every direction. The broiling tray also developed tears at the center, where they would usually get bent while washing.I was on the lookout for a 9" x 12" (or shorter than 12") stainless steel broiling tray and pan that would fit in my toaster oven. This Norpro stainless steel roasting and broiling pan fits the bill. Its dimensions are:Width (with triangular "handle" turned inward) ...............11-7/8" (30.2 cm)Depth.................................................................................9" (23 cm)Height (perforated pan stacked on solid pan).....................1-7/16" (3.7 cm)Height (perforated pan only).................................................1.4 cmI find the height of the stacked pieces too tall (3.7 cm) when heating, broiling, baking thicker food (e.g., chicken). I get around it by just setting the perforated tray on top of my older aluminum solid pan. That shaves off > 2 cm from the height of the broiler pan.In more than a year of daily use, the trays have not rusted or warped. I either handwash or wash it in the dishwasher, depending on whether I have a full dishwasher load or not. I handwash using a brush so I don't have to scrub each indented square individually with a scouring pad.
